      The theory behind this is that you might want to give your TIN a starting shape before you begin using the Smoove tool to modify it. This allows for TINs that have much greater rotation than possible when starting with a flat TIN.

          @majid said:

          and how did u made suche a spiral tin?

          Hi majid,

          BTW, really liked the whales. The spiral TIN was made by duplicating a single row TIN that I first twisted a little by selecting one of the long side lines and rotating that line slightly.
